Join us for this Edinburgh Preview Special, featuring two superb acts road testing their material before a trip to the Edinburgh Fringe…

John Gordillo, returned to live stand up in 2008 after 6 years writing and directing to widespread critical acclaim…His last Edinburgh show “Divide and Conga” gained 4 and 5 star reviews throughout the run and sparked a huge emotional response from the audience.

“Gordillo is an inspiration, a consummate performer with an amazing talent, passion and intellect.” Chortle

“One of our finest stand-ups” – Evening Standard

Russell Kane was nominated for the main prize the if.Comedy at last years Fringe. Strap in for some super-speed sunderings and inconvenient sociology in an hour of self-soiling merriment that will leave you with rickets.

As Seen on Live at The Apollo, Five US and Big Brother’s Little Brother.

“Russell Kane is an exceptional comedian, his pace is relentless and his material beautifully observed and exquisitely crafted… This is inspiring and brilliant stand-up… perfect.” *****Chortle

“The kind of gags that make you snort beer out of your nose… An impressive punchline rate.” ****Metro

Al Pitcher

Every day we see things we’ve never seen before, things that strike us as odd or beautiful, and things that we’ve seen so many times we don’t even notice them any more… Not Al Pitcher. His mind is constantly twisting, flipping and distorting what he sees, igniting the mundane, and for The Al Pitcher Picture show, weaving the events of his day in your town into a truly unique and hilarious one-off show. Every comic will tell you that a ‘funny thing happened on the way to the gig’, but, digital camera in hand, Al has the pictures to prove it! What does Al Pitcher make of Leicester? There’s only one way to find out…

Fresh from sell-out shows in Australia and New Zealand, don’t miss your chance to catch Al Pitcher on his extended UK tour with this multi-award winning show.

Best Show 2009 – Leicester Comedy Festival Awards

Director’s Pick 2009 – Newcastle Gateshead Comedy Festival

Time Out Sydney’s People’s Choice Award 2009

“Pitcher sits firmly in the improvising, rambling, freewheeling comedy camp inhabited by the likes of Ross Noble and Eddie Izzard. However, unlike both of them, Pitcher is one of the best kept secrets on the comedy scene. But it’s only a matter of time” – Time Out
